java 函数通过代码重用、模块化和可维护性带来优势,包括内存开销、执行开销和命名冲突等缺点。を活用することで、コードの再利用性、モジュール性、保守性の向上などのメリットが得られる一方で、メモリーオーバヘッド、実行オーバヘッド、名前の衝突などのデメリットもある。メリットとデメリットを比較検討することで、開発者はアプリケーションで関数を賢く活用できる。
Java 函数的利与弊全方位解析
简介
函数是 Java 中将代码块组织成可重用单元的强大工具。它们有助于代码模块化、提高可读性和可维护性。但函数也有其利弊,了解这些利弊至关重要。
优点
缺点
实战案例
以下是一个计算两个整数最大公约数的 Java 函数示例:
public static int gcd(int a, int b) {
if (b == 0) {
return a;
}
return gcd(b, a % b);
}这个函数通过反复除以较小整数的余数来有效地计算最大公约数。
结论
Java 函数是强
大的工具,可以提高代码的可复用性、模块化和可维护性。然而,它们也有一些缺点,如内存和执行开销以及潜在的命名冲突。通过权衡利弊,开发者可以在他们的应用程序中明智地使用函数。